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
35639543265 65631175733 54222605555 87121900 79297955610
32492027 560538
32492027 560538
619 202 1581
All about undefined
Interested in learning more?
32492027 560538
619 202 1581
See more
938527437 29
497 2843022464 43976043878 413022868 7852139952
See more
22193837469 25
76 23 083 3602148
See more